GROVECREST SCHOOL

Grovecrest School is a public elementary school that is part of the Alpine District school district, located in PLEASANT GROVE, UT with about 757 students offering grade levels from Pre-Kindergarten to 6th Grade. Student demographics can be found below.

Grovecrest Elementary School is a public school located in Pleasant Grove, Utah, serving students as part of the Alpine School District. Situated in a suburban setting, the school focuses on providing a foundational education that emphasizes academic achievement, character development, and community engagement. As part of one of Utah’s largest school districts, Grovecrest benefits from the resources and standardized curriculum provided by Alpine, while maintaining a local culture centered on supporting the growth and well-being of its young students.

The school is dedicated to fostering a supportive learning environment that encourages both intellectual curiosity and social-emotional growth. By integrating core subjects like language arts, mathematics, and science with extracurricular opportunities, Grovecrest aims to prepare its students for the transition to middle school. Through its connection to the Alpine School District, the school emphasizes strong parental involvement and a collaborative approach to education, ensuring that students have the necessary tools to succeed within the local community and beyond.

* A public charter school is a publicly funded school that is typically governed by a group or organization under a legislative contract with the state, the district, or another entity. The charter exempts the school from certain state or local rules and regulations.

1 The National School Lunch Program (NSLP) provides eligible students with free or reduced-price lunch

2 Title I, Part A (Title I) of the Elementary and Secondary Education Act provides supplemental financial assistance to school districts for children from low-income families.

School Demographics for 757 students

The primary ethnicity of students attending GROVECREST SCHOOL is predominantly White, representing about 90% of the student body.

White
89.8%
Hispanic/Latino
5.5%
Two or more races
2.5%
Black or African American
1.1%
Asian
0.8%
Native Hawaiian or Other Pacific Islander
0.1%
American Indian or Alaska Native
0.1%

Female
48.9%
Male
51.1%
